> > On Mon, 16 Feb 2026 at 04:15, David Niklas <simd@xxxxxxxxxxx> wrote:
> > >
> > > Hello,
> > > I upgraded my kernel from 6.9 to 6.17. They're both the "same"
> > > custom config. I tried:
> > >
> > > # echo 200000 > /sys/devices/virtual/block/md7/md/sync_speed
> > > bash: /sys/devices/virtual/block/md7/md/sync_speed: Permission
> > > denied # id
> > > uid=0(root) gid=0(root) groups=0(root)
> > >
> > > This used to work. Any ideas as to what I could have set wrong? I
> > > haven't a clue!
